#!/usr/bin/env python
import glob
import logging
import os
import subprocess
import sys
import shutil
import tkinter
from tkinter import filedialog
from optparse import OptionParser
# Global information
__uname__ = 'crkMKV'
__long_name__ = 'Convert all movies into MKV & add all subtitles'
__version__ = '0.1'
__author__ = 'Denis Sandor'
__email__ = 'dxcore35@gmail.com'
__license__ = 'MIT'
# Colors (ANSI)
RED = '31'
GREEN = '32'
ORANGE = '33'
def show_authors(*args, **kwargs):
# //// Show authors
print('%s v%s, %s' % (__uname__, __version__, __long_name__))
print('%s <%s>' % (__author__, __email__))
print(__license__)
sys.exit(0)
def write_text(text, desc=sys.stdout, color=None):
# Write the text with color, if tty
if color is not None and desc.isatty():
desc.write('\x1b[%sm%s\x1b[0m' % (color, text))
else:
desc.write(text)
desc.flush()
def shell_arguments():
"""
Configure optparse
"""
usage = "usage: %prog [options] file1 file2 ..."
parser = OptionParser(usage=usage, version="%prog " + __version__)
# Print information
parser.add_option(
'-d', '--debug',
action='store_true',
dest='debug',
help='be extra verbose',
default=False
)
parser.add_option(
'-a', '--authors',
action='callback',
callback=show_authors,
help='show authors'
)
return parser
def check_mkvmerge():
# /// Check if mkvmerge is installed
try:
subprocess.check_call(['mkvmerge', '-V'], stdout=subprocess.PIPE)
except OSError:
return False
return True
def GetAllMovies(path):
import os, sys
file_paths = []
counter = 0
for folder, subs, files in os.walk(path):
for filename in files:
if not filename.startswith('.'):
if filename.find('.mkv') is not -1:
file_paths.append(os.path.abspath(os.path.join(folder, filename)))
elif filename.find('.avi') is not -1:
file_paths.append(os.path.abspath(os.path.join(folder, filename)))
elif filename.find('.mp4') is not -1:
file_paths.append(os.path.abspath(os.path.join(folder, filename)))
elif filename.find('.m4v') is not -1:
file_paths.append(os.path.abspath(os.path.join(folder, filename)))
return file_paths
def analyze_path(path): # CONVERT MOVIE (convert / update file format)
for movies in GetAllMovies(path):
absolute_path = movies
if os.path.isfile(absolute_path):
convert_video(absolute_path)
return True
def language_short(lang): # //// Get the language code from the language name
values = dict(SK='Slovak', ENG='English', DE='German',CZ='Czech')
tmp_lng = values.get(lang.lower(), None)
if tmp_lng is None:
tmp_lng = values.get(lang, None)
return tmp_lng
def language_coding(lang): # //// Get the language coding from the language short name
values = dict(sk='CP1250', eng='UTF-8', de='UTF-8', cz='CP1250')
tmp_lng = values.get(lang.lower(), None)
if tmp_lng is None:
tmp_lng = values.get(lang, None)
return tmp_lng
def find_subtitles(path): # //// Find all the subtitles of the video
files = glob.glob(path + '*.srt')
languages = []
for filename in files:
language = filename[len(path):-4].strip().strip('.')
if not language:
language = 'No language element found (sufix: SK,ENG,CZ...) so setting english as default language.'
languages.append([language_short("ENG"), "ENG", filename])
else:
languages.append([language_short(language), language, filename])
logging.info("Found a subtitle with the name '%s'", language)
return languages
def create_command(input_filename, output_filename, subtitles, type): # //// Create the mkvmerge command
command = ['mkvmerge']
command.append('-o') # Append the output file
command.append(output_filename)
command.append(input_filename) # Append the input file
# //// Handle all subtitles
for subtitle in subtitles:
command.append('--language')
command.append('0:%s' % subtitle[0])
command.append('--sub-charset')
command.append('0:%s' % language_coding(subtitle[1]))
command.append('--track-name')
command.append('0:%s' % subtitle[1])
command.append(subtitle[2])
logging.info(command)
return command
def convert_video(path): # Update the found videos to matroska if there are subtitles
REMOVE_INPUT = False # REMOVE INPUT FILE
main_dir = os.path.dirname(path) + "/"
converted_dir = main_dir + "converted/" # DEFAULT OUTPUT DIRECTORY FOR OK MKVs
withoutsub_dir = main_dir + "no_subtitles/"
error_dir = main_dir + "wrong_formatting/"
if not os.path.exists(converted_dir):
os.makedirs(converted_dir)
logging.info("Trying to update / convert %s", path)
path_without_ext = os.path.splitext(path)[0]
file_name = os.path.basename(path_without_ext)
output_filename = converted_dir + file_name + '_.mkv'
subs = find_subtitles(path_without_ext)
write_text('[SUB]:' + str(subs) + '\n', sys.stdout, ORANGE)
if len(subs) is not 0:
command = create_command(path, output_filename, subs, 'update')
c = subprocess.call(command, stdout=subprocess.PIPE)
if c == 0:
write_text('[DONE]:' + file_name + '\n', sys.stdout, GREEN)
if not os.path.dirname(path_without_ext) == main_dir:
shutil.rmtree(os.path.dirname(path_without_ext))
else:
write_text('[ERRR]:' + file_name + '\n', sys.stdout, RED)
if not os.path.exists(error_dir):
os.makedirs(error_dir)
else:
command = create_command(path, output_filename, subs, 'update')
c = subprocess.call(command, stdout=subprocess.PIPE)
write_text('[SKIP]:' + file_name+ '\n', sys.stdout, ORANGE)
if not os.path.exists(withoutsub_dir):
os.makedirs(withoutsub_dir)
#shutil.move(os.path.dirname(path_without_ext), withoutsub_dir)
return c == 0
def main(): # Entry point
arg_parser = shell_arguments()
(options, paths) = arg_parser.parse_args()
if not paths:
root = tkinter.Tk()
root.withdraw()
path = filedialog.askdirectory(parent=root,initialdir="/",title='Please select a directory')
# Configure the logging module
if options.debug:
level = logging.INFO
else:
level = logging.WARNING
logging.basicConfig(
level=level,
format='%(asctime)s %(levelname)s: %(message)s',
datefmt='%Y-%m-%d %H:%M:%S'
)
if not check_mkvmerge():
print('mkvtoolnix is not installed in your system')
print('You need the mkvmerge command to run this script')
sys.exit(-1)
#for path in paths:
logging.info('Looking for all the avi/mp4/mkv files in %s', path)
analyze_path(path)
if __name__ == '__main__':
main()
# vim: ai ts=4 sts=4 et sw=4
